 *‘Elio’ Shines with Heart, Humor, and Hope: Zoe Saldana and others reflect on Disney Pixar's touching new tale* 


Disney Pixar’s latest animated feature, Elio, promises more than just visual spectacle—it’s a moving, fun-filled journey centered around identity, love, and the courage to be yourself. As the film nears its release, stars Zoe Saldaña, Yonas Kibreab, and Jameela Jamil share insights about the powerful themes behind the story, the characters, and what they hope audiences take away from this universal tale.


“I really hope that fans are able to go to the movie theater to really just admire and celebrate all the hard work that these animators have put together with Elio,” said Saldaña at New York Red Carpet premiere of Elio.  “It’s a compelling story, it’s all heart, but it’s very fun and it’s also very funny.”



Saldaña voices Olga, Elio’s aunt, a character who, at the heart of it, represents unconditional love.  When asked what she wants parents to take away from the film, Saldaña shared a particularly poignant moment: “Olga says a very important line to Elio, and she says, ‘I may not understand you, but I love you.’ And I think that says a lot. Olga realizes that part of her relationship with Elio is about just loving him more than she can understand him and I think that's important,” she added.


At the center of the film is young Elio himself, voiced by Yonas Kibreab, who brings a quiet strength and authenticity to the character. For Kibreab, the journey of Elio is deeply personal and widely relatable. “I feel like no matter what age you are, you'll get something out of this movie,” Kibreab said. “And I feel with me, for as long as I've been working on it, the main thing that's been speaking to me is just always stay myself and never change who I am.”


The film doesn’t shy away from heavy emotions either, offering comfort to those who feel out of place or burdened by their own grief. “If you're feeling grief or feeling alone at times just like Elio, I just want them to really understand that everything is gonna be OK and you'll get through it just like Elio does,” said Kibreab.


Jameela Jamil, who lends her voice to the elegant and enigmatic Ambassador Questa, sees Elio as a story about unexpected strength and boundless hope. “This film is ultimately a message of hope and it's a message of the fact that it's often the people you never imagine anything of who can do the things you could never imagine,” said Jamil. “And I think that perfectly applies to Elio.”


_Disney Pixar releases Elio in Indian theatres on June 20 in English, Hindi, Tamil, and Telugu._
